Echoes of Emotion
Regret:
In the echoes of choices past,
A hand scrubs, regret amassed.
Sighing heavily, burdened with woe,
Regret's bitter seed, beginning to sow.
Downturned mouth, a somber refrain,
Bending slightly, under regret's strain.
Shoulders low, burdened and bowed,
In regret's shroud, we're silently cowed.
Grief:
In the shadows where sorrow weaves its tale,
A vacant look, an empty sail.
Facial expressions slack, like a canvas bleak,
Tears rolling down, a silent creek.
Shaky hands betray the heart's lament,
Trembling lips, in grief they're bent.
Struggling to breathe, a weight unseen,
Grief's heavy burden, a constant sheen.
Envy:
Amidst the green hues of envy's grasp,
Eyes narrow, in envy's clasp.
Rolling eyes, a silent sigh,
Beneath the surface, envy's lie.
Clenching fists, a hidden strain,
Tightening jaw, a silent pain.
Crossing arms, a defensive shield,
In envy's field, our fate's revealed.
Fondness:
In the glow of affection's light,
Smiling with eyes, oh so bright.
Softening features, a tender caress,
In fondness's embrace, we find our rest.
Reaching out, longing to touch,
Yearning for closeness, oh so much.
A connection sought, in every glance,
In fondness's dance, we find our chance.
Survive:
Through regret's storm and envy's sting,
Grief's heavy burden, fondness's ring,
We navigate the tempest's roar,
Emerging stronger than before.
For in the echoes of emotion's sway,
We find the courage to face the day.
United in our human drive,
We endure, we persist, we thrive.
